Abstract

Objective To observe the inhibitory effect of angiotensin-(1-7) on liver fibrosis induced by bile duct ligation in Tats. Methods Eighteen Wistar rats were randomized into 3 groups and subject to sham operation, bile duct ligation (BDL), or BDL with angiotensin-(1-7) treatment. An osmotic minipump was implanted intraperitoneally for administration of saline in the sham-operated and BDL groups and angiotensin-(1-7) (25 μg·kg-1·h-1) in angiotensin-(1-7) treatment group. After a 4-week treatments, the fibrosis score, Masson staining, and hydroxyproline assay were used to evaluate the level of liver fibrosis in the rats, and irnrnunohistochemistry was used to detect expression of a-smooth muscle actin (a-SMA) in the liver tissue. Results Compared with BDL group, a 4-week treatment with angiotensin-(1-7) following BDL significantly reduced the fibrosis score (2.33 ±0.52 vs 5.17 +0.75), hydroxyproline content (0.36±0.03 vs 0.52±0.04) and a-SMA expression (54.11±17.55 vs 191.84±31.72) in the liver tissue of the rats (P<0.01). Conclusion Prolonged infusion of angiotensin-(1-7) inhibit the formation of hepatic fibrosis in rats following bile duct ligation.
